超Vue.js 完全ガイド2024 (Vue Router, Pinia含む)
Vue.js 3を基礎から、Vue Router、Pinia、TypeScriptを使った実践的な内容まで網羅的に学びますので、ぜひご受講ください。ReactやAngularなど他のJavaScriptフレームワークをお使いの方もぜひ!
4.49 (3888 reviews)
16,627
students
32.5 hours
content
Apr 2024
last update
$19.99
regular price
What you will learn
Vueの基礎から、コンポーネントの使い方、仮想DOM、アニメーション、Composableなどの応用的な機能
Vue Router、Pinia、TypeScriptなどを使用した大規模なシングルページアプリケーション(SPA)の作成と、それらを世界中に公開する方法
Vue 3のComposition APIやViteをベースにした最新の開発手法、リアクティビティシステム、Options API
Vueを使ったデモのWebアプリケーションの作成とそれを実際に公開する方法
Why take this course?
この講座は、Vue.js 3の最新機能を含む、Viteを使用したプロジェクトのセットアップから、Vue RouterやPinia、Cloudflare Pagesへのデプロイまで、Vue.jsに関する広範囲の内容を網羅しています。Udemy上では、この程度の完全なガイドを提供する日本語の講座は他に無い可能性が高く、特に以下のような場合に適しています。
1. **Vue.js初心者**: HTML、CSS、JavaScriptの基礎を少し学び始めた方で、Vue.jsの具体的な使い方や、Composable、Pinia、TypeScriptなどの高度な機能について学びたいとき。
2. **プログラミング経験がある開発者**: 既にプログラミングスキルを持っており、Vue.jsに特化したいとき。この講座では、最新の開発手法やツールを紹介しており、技術スタックをアップデートする際の参考材料となるでしょう。
3. **Vue.jsのオプションAPIからComposable Functionに移行したい開発者**: Vue.3の新機能に興味があり、オプションAPIの継続からComposable Functionへの移行を図っている方。
4. **TypeScriptを勉強したい開発者**: TypeScriptとVue.jsを組み合わせて使用する方法を学びたければ、この講座はボーナス部分でその役割を果たします。
5. **実際のプロジェクトにVue.jsを導入したい開発者**: 実際のプロジェクト(Single Page Applicationやマルチページアプリケーション)にVue.jsを取り入れ、その全プロセスを学びたければ、この講座は役立ちます。
この講座では、理解しやすいテンポで、実際のデモアプリを作成しながら、Vue.jsの各機能やベストプラクティスを学びます。また、Cloudflare Pagesを使ったデプロイメントも含まれており、実際にアプリケーションを世界中どこでもアクセス可能な状態にしる方法も学べます。
講座の内容は、初心者から経験豊富な開発者まで、幅広く対応しており、Vue.jsの世界を深く掘り下げたいときに最適な選択becomes.
Screenshots
Our review
顧客のフィードバックをもとに、以下のような改善点を提案します:
1. **解説のスピードと明瞭性**:
- 解説者の喋り速さを適度に調整し、内容が明確に伝わるようにする。
- 複雑なトピックや新しい概念のために、簡略化した要約や概説を事前に用意しておくことで、受け者が跟って取り組めるようにする。
2. **実際のコードの表示**:
- レクチャー中のコード変更や実施するタイミングを考える。受講者が自分のコードと同時に注意して聴できるような隙を設ける。
3. **学習資料の提供**:
- 各レクチャーごとの完全なコードが欲ですが、初心者向けのサンプルコードや、各ステップの詳細など、受講者が自分の環境で動画を一度停止して参照することも考える。
4. **Older Versionsの明確な標記**:
- Vue 2 版の占め率(例:Vue 2 版が6割を占める)を明確に示することで、受講者がどうも理解しやすくなりする。
5. **学習計画の提供**:
- Vue.jsの基礎から始める人向けた学習路線を提案する。
6. **期待の管理**:
- axios などの HTTP 通信の Vue3 バージョンについての期待を明記し、そのタイミングを受講者に伝える。
7. **セクタリズムの改善**:
- 各レクチャーごとのコードが分かったりするタイミングを改善し、受講者が必要な情報を簡単に得られるようにする。
8. **個人的な要求への対応**:
- 受講者が特定のセクターのコードを求めている場合、その要求を慎重視する。
9. **技術のアップデートとの対応**:
- Vue.jsのバージョン更新に関わる上で、Vue3 が推奨された状態になった後も、Vue 2 の基本的知識を確保する。
10. **フィードバックの活用**:
- 受講者からのフィードバックを�固にし、それを製品の改善に反映させる。
これらの提案は、受講者がより効果的に学習できるための改善点を示するものです。顧客の声を尊重し、それを製品やサービスの改善に活用することで、講座の全体的な品質を高めくことができます。
Charts
Price
Rating
Enrollment distribution
Related Topics
2426224
udemy ID
6/23/2019
course created date
10/29/2019
course indexed date
Bot
course submited by